Brent Novoselsky
Brent Howard Novoselsky (born January 8, 1966), is a former professional American football tight end in the National Football League.

Novoselsky, who is Jewish, was born in Skokie, Illinois.
Novoselsky's career highlight NFL catch was during a Monday Night Football game with the Minnesota Vikings against the Cincinnati Bengals on Christmas night in 1989. His 1-yard TD grab from Wade Wilson in the fourth quarter helped put the Vikings up 29-21, the game's final score, which gave the Vikings the division title over Green Bay, with whom they shared a 10-6 record. Otherwise, Minnesota would have missed the playoffs with a loss.
